Support you may be entitled to

  • If you chose a care home based in England, you may be eligible for NHS Funded Nursing Care (FNC), which helps cover the cost of nursing. This is worth £267.68 per week and is usually paid directly to the care home.

Review from Jackie D (Stepdaughter of Resident) published on 23 December 2019 Submitted via Postal Card
Overall Experience

My stepfather had been in Sycamore before a couple of years ago and thrived there. He was moved into independent living again as he made so much progress in the few months he was there. He is now back, at my request, following some weeks at hospital with 3 bouts of pneumonia. I was told he wouldn't live for more than a week, but after a month in Sycamores on end of life care, he is eating meals, drinking, socialising and enjoying life. Thanks to the proper homely environment and wonderful 'family of staff'. Even I, at the age of 66, wouldn't mind a stay in there to enjoy all that's on offer. (I don't need it, thank God). Not modernised or posh or starchy, but home in the true sense.

Review from J D (Stepdaughter of Resident) published on 30 January 2018 Submitted via Postal Card
Overall Experience

When a relative is admitted to a care home we worry that they will not be properly looked after or stimulated in unfamiliar surroundings/faces they become distressed/depressed. This home has an air of happy competent support with lots of laughter and chatter. The rooms are beautiful and homely and visitors and residents are treated with the utmost respect. Clothes are laundered and ironed well, food is good and never a smell of urine (or other) when you walk in reflecting the standard of care throughout this facility. My step-father is happy from day one and looks 10 years younger. It feels like one big family supporting one another this reflects directly on the management as an organisation is only ever as good as the one at the top.

Meet the Team (1)

Winnie Muthiga Job Title: Registered Manager Joined: 2024
Winnie Muthiga

I joined Springcare in June 2024 as the Manager for Sycamore and Poplars Care Home. With over 18 years of experience in the NHS and social care industry, my passion for caregiving has been the driving force throughout my career. My journey began at Thames Valley University London where I trained to be an RGN. I have held various roles including RGN, Clinical Lead, Deputy Manager, and Home Manager, each contributing to my deep commitment to providing exceptional care.

Living with my grandmother during her last five years and participating in her care profoundly enriched my dedication to the field. Making a positive difference has always been my motto and motivation. I embrace the challenges in my career as they inspire me to grow and improve continually. Outside of work, I cherish spending time with my family and enjoy cooking. I participate in marathons to raise funds for worthy causes, combining my love for fitness with philanthropy. To unwind, I delight in reading a good old-fashioned hardcover book.
